Narrow Range Ethoxylates are a type of surfactant, a substance that reduces surface tension between two liquids or between a liquid and a solid. They are used in a variety of industries, including personal care, home care, industrial and institutional cleaning, and oilfield applications. Narrow Range Ethoxylates are typically made from fatty alcohols, which are derived from natural sources such as vegetable oils and animal fats. They are used to improve the performance of products, such as detergents, shampoos, and cosmetics, by providing better wetting, foaming, and emulsifying properties. Narrow Range Ethoxylates are a cost-effective and environmentally friendly alternative to other surfactants, such as alkylphenol ethoxylates (APEs). They are also more biodegradable than APEs, making them a preferred choice for many industries.
